"""
|
|
Cron job storage and execution.
|
|
|
|
Handles reading/writing CRONS.json and running jobs when they fire.
|
|
Imported by scheduler.py (to load jobs at startup) and tools/cron.py
|
|
(to add/remove jobs at runtime).
|
|
|
|
Job schema:
|
|
{
|
|
"id": "c_abc123",
|
|
"label": "Human-readable name",
|
|
"schedule": "daily:09:00", # see parse_schedule() for all formats
|
|
"type": "remind" | "note" | "message" | "brief",
|
|
"payload": "Text or prompt when the job fires",
|
|
"channel": null | "nextcloud" | "google_chat", # for message/brief types
|
|
"enabled": true,
|
|
"created_at": "ISO 8601",
|
|
"last_run": null | "ISO 8601"
|
|
}
|
|
|
|
Job types:
|
|
remind → appends to REMINDERS.md (auto-loaded into context at tier 2+)
|
|
note → appends to SCRATCH.md (read on demand via scratch_read)
|
|
message → sends payload as-is to NC Talk notification_room
|
|
brief → runs LLM with payload as the prompt, sends response to NC Talk
|
|
(good for morning briefings, summaries, proactive check-ins)
|
|
"""

def parse_schedule(schedule: str) -> dict:
|
|
"""
|
|
Convert a human schedule string to APScheduler cron kwargs.
|
|
|
|
Formats:
|
|
"hourly" → every hour at :00
|
|
"daily" → every day at 09:00
|
|
"daily:HH:MM" → every day at HH:MM
|
|
"weekly:DOW" → every DOW at 09:00
|
|
"weekly:DOW:HH:MM" → every DOW at HH:MM
|
|
"""
|
|
s = schedule.strip().lower()
|
|
|
|
if s == "hourly":
|
|
return {"minute": 0}
|
|
|
|
if s == "daily":
|
|
return {"hour": _DEFAULT_HOUR, "minute": _DEFAULT_MINUTE}
|
|
|
|
if s.startswith("daily:"):
|
|
h, m = _parse_hhmm(s[6:], schedule)
|
|
return {"hour": h, "minute": m}
|
|
|
|
if s.startswith("weekly:"):
|
|
rest = s[7:].split(":")
|
|
dow = _DOW.get(rest[0])
|
|
if not dow:
|
|
raise ValueError(
|
|
f"Unknown day of week {rest[0]!r}. "
|
|
f"Use: mon tue wed thu fri sat sun"
|
|
)
|
|
if len(rest) == 3:
|
|
h, m = _parse_hhmm(f"{rest[1]}:{rest[2]}", schedule)
|
|
else:
|
|
h, m = _DEFAULT_HOUR, _DEFAULT_MINUTE
|
|
return {"day_of_week": dow, "hour": h, "minute": m}
|
|
|
|
raise ValueError(
|
|
f"Unrecognised schedule {schedule!r}. "
|
|
f"Valid formats: hourly | daily | daily:HH:MM | weekly:DOW | weekly:DOW:HH:MM"
|
|
)
|
|
|
|
|
|
def _parse_hhmm(s: str, original: str) -> tuple[int, int]:
|
|
parts = s.split(":")
|
|
if len(parts) != 2:
|
|
raise ValueError(f"Expected HH:MM in {original!r}, got {s!r}")
|
|
return int(parts[0]), int(parts[1])
